1.7.1.13
more
QueF binds substrate preQ0 in a strongly exothermic process (DeltaH 80.3 kJ/mol) whereby the thioimide adduct is formed with half-of-the-sites reactivity in the homodimeric enzyme. Both steps of preQ0 reduction involve transfer of the 4-pro-R-hydrogen from NADPH. They proceed about 4-7fold more slowly than trapping of the enzyme-bound preQ0 as covalent thioimide and are mainly rate-limiting for the enzyme's kcat
Escherichia coli
